It took over three decades, but Atlanta restaurateur Tom Murphy finally began expanding his empire in 2014 with the opening of Paces & Vine. Now he’s adding a third.

Murphy’s newest restaurant, Morningside Kitchen, will serve “neighborhood comfort food” in the Virginia Highland space previously occupied by Rosebud. Over the next few weeks, we’re going behind the scenes into the launch of the new concept, opening soon on N. Highland Avenue. Today, you’ll get a sneak peak from the team from October 2015 as they prepare to open the doors.
